L-subshell ionization cross sections for uranium by proton and alpha-particle bombardment

X rays resulting from L-shell vacancies in uranium atoms, produced by bombarding thin targets with protons (2.0--18.0 MeV) and alphas (3.0--16.0 MeV) were measured using a Si(Li) x-ray detector. L-subshell ionization cross sections for uranium were extracted from the L..cap alpha../sub 1//sub ,//sub 2/, L..gamma../sub 1/, and L..gamma../sub 4//sub ,//sub 4//sub prime/ x-ray transitions. The observed projectile energy dependences are reasonably well reproduced by plane-wave Born, semiclassical, and binary-encounter approximation calculations at the higher energies, but show significant discrepancies below 2 MeV/amu. The ratios of sigma/sub L/1/sigma/sub L/2/ and sigma/sub L/3/sigma/sub L/2/ also show departures from theoretical predictions at low energies. (AIP)
